| /*--- |
| description: BigInt stringify order of steps |
| esid: sec-serializejsonproperty |
| info: | |
| Runtime Semantics: SerializeJSONProperty ( key, holder ) |
| |
| 2. If Type(value) is Object or BigInt, then |
| a. Let toJSON be ? GetGetV(value, "toJSON"). |
| b. If IsCallable(toJSON) is true, then |
| i. Set value to ? Call(toJSON, value, « key »). |
| 3. If ReplacerFunction is not undefined, then |
| a. Set value to ? Call(ReplacerFunction, holder, « key, value »). |
| 4. If Type(value) is Object, then |
| [...] |
| d. Else if value has a [[BigIntData]] internal slot, then |
| i. Set value to value.[[BigIntData]]. |
| [...] |
| 10. If Type(value) is BigInt, throw a TypeError exception |
| features: [BigInt, arrow-function] |
| ---*/ |
